David Eberly

DANVILLE – David Leroy Eberly, 61, of Danville died at 5:15 p.m. Thursday (Nov. 22, 2001) at Danville Care Center, Danville.

Funeral services will be at 10 a.m. Monday at Pape Memorial Home & Gardens, 10 E. Williams St., Danville. Pastor Gene Grubb will officiate. Burial will be at Danville National cemetery, with military rites by Danville Veterans of Foreign Wars Post 728.

Visitation will be from 2 to 5 p.m. Sunday at the funeral home.

Wilkin Freeman

CHAMPAIGN – Wilkin E. Freeman, 89, of Champaign died at 9 a.m. Wednesday (Nov. 21, 2001) at Veterans Affairs Illiana Health Systems, Danville.

Funeral services will be at noon Monday at Salem Baptist Church, 500 E. Park St., C, the Rev. Claude Shelby officiating. Burial will be in Mount Hope cemetery, Champaign.

Visitation will be from 10 a.m. to noon Monday at the church. Graveside military rites will be accorded by Champaign Veterans of Foreign Wars Post No. 5520.

Heath and Vaughn Funeral Home, 201 N. Elm St., C., is handling arrangements.

Minnie Huser

TUSCOLA – Minnie Huser, 105, of Tuscola died at 5:10 a.m. Friday (Nov. 23, 2001) at the Tuscola Nightingale Manor Nursing Home, Tuscola.

Funeral arrangements were incomplete at the Hilligoss Shrader Funeral Home, Tuscola.

Marjorie Kinney

DANVILLE – Marjorie P. Kinney, 77, of Danville died at 9:10 a.m. Friday (Nov. 23, 2001) at Provena United Samaritans Medical Center, Logan campus, Danville.

Funeral services will be at 2 p.m. Monday at Morrison Funeral Home, 101 Maiden Lane, Bismarck. Charles Fetters will officiate. Burial will be at Walnut Corner cemetery, southeast of Bismarck.

Visitation will be from 2 to 5 p.m. Sunday at the funeral home.

Michael Long

URBANA – Funeral services for Michael W. Long, 49, of Urbana will be at 11 a.m. today at Calvert Funeral Home, 201 S. Center St., Clinton. J. Kent Hickerson will officiate. Burial will be in Memorial Park cemetery, Clinton.

Visitation will be from 10 to 11 a.m. today at the funeral home.

Mr. Long died at 10:27 a.m. Thursday (Nov. 22, 2001) at OSF St. Joseph Medical Center, Bloomington.

Jacob Morenz

SADORUS – Jacob G. F. Morenz, 87, of Sadorus died at 11:45 a.m. Friday (Nov. 23, 2001) at the Champaign County Nursing Home, Urbana.

Funeral services will be at 11 a.m. Monday at St. Paul's Lutheran Church, Sadorus, the Rev. Jack Miller officiating. Burial will be at Craw cemetery, Sadorus.

Visitation will be from 10 to 11 a.m. Monday at the church. Freese Funeral Home, Tolono, is handling arrangements.

Edith A. Newman

RANTOUL – Funeral services for Edith A. Newman, 76, formerly of the Potomac-Rossville area and of Rantoul, will be Monday at St. Lawrence Catholic Church, Penfield, with the Rev. Bill Keebler officiating. Burial will be in St. Lawrence cemetery, Penfield.

Visitation will be from 4 to 7 p.m. Sunday at Wolfe Funeral Home, 400 N. Vermilion St., Potomac, where a rosary service will be held Sunday evening.

Mrs. Newman died at 3:15 p.m. Thursday (Nov. 22, 2001) at Manor Care Nursing Home, Champaign.

Marian Peifer

CHAMPAIGN – Funeral services for Marian M. Peifer, 83, of Champaign, will be at 3 p.m. today at the Mount Hope Mausoleum Chapel, Champaign. Chaplain Glen Corbly officiating will officiate.

Visitation will be from 2 to 3 p.m. today at the chapel. Mittendorf-Calvert Funeral Home, 2400 Galen Drive, C, is in charge of arrangements.

Mrs. Peifer died at 8:45 p.m. Wednesday (Nov. 21, 2001) at home.

Donald Rasner

CHAMPAIGN – Donald Rasner, 68, of Champaign died Friday morning (Nov. 23, 2001) at Provena Covenant Medical Center, Urbana.

Funeral arrangements are incomplete at Owens Funeral Home, Champaign.

Teddy Sample

URBANA – Teddy G. Sample, 58, of 106 Dewey St., U., died at 12:15 a.m. Wednesday (Nov. 21, 2001) at the University of Illinois-Chicago Medical Center.

Funeral services will be at 10 a.m. Tuesday at Renner-Wikoff Chapel, 1900 S. Philo Road, U. The Rev. Morris Christman will officiate. Burial will be in Cerro Gordo cemetery.

Visitation will be from 6 to 8 p.m. Monday at the funeral home.

Cameron Schrock Cody Schrock

ARCOLA – Cameron David Schrock and Cody Joseph Schrock, infant sons of David and Crystal Schrock of Mattoon, were stillborn Nov. 13, 2001, at St. John's Hospital, Springfield.

Private services will be today. - The Rev. Robert Clark will officiate. Burial will be in Arcola cemetery.

Edwards Funeral Home, Arcola, is in charge of arrangements.

Ralph Scott

SAVOY – Ralph Leslie Scott, 87, of Urbana died at 2:43 a.m. Oct. 31, 2001, at The Carle Arbours, Savoy.

No funeral services were conducted.

Janet Spohn

URBANA – Janet Loraine Spohn, 56, of 1205 E. Green St., U, died at 4:10 p.m. Thursday (Nov. 22, 2001) at Carle Foundation Hospital, Urbana.

A memorial service will be conducted later. Renner-Wikoff Chapel, Urbana, is handling arrangements.

Mary Tuggle

DANVILLE – Mary Elizabeth Bright Tuggle, 68, of Danville died at 2:50 p.m. Thursday (Nov. 22, 2001) at Provena United Samaritans Medical Center, Logan campus, Danville.

Funeral services will be at 11 a.m. Monday at Houghton-Leasure Funeral Home, 200 E. Water St., Georgetown. Charles Allen will officiate. Burial will be in Georgetown cemetery.

Visitation will be from 1 to 4 p.m. Sunday at the funeral home.

Michael Weaver

PAXTON – Michael E. Weaver, 54, of Paxton died at 4:50 p.m. Friday (Nov. 23, 2001) at home.Arrangements were incomplete at Ford-Baier Funeral Home, Paxton.

Elsa Wienke

DANVILLE – Elsa Wienke, 61, of Danville died Wednesday (Nov. 21, 2001) at Provena United Samaritans Medical Center, Danville.

There will be no graveside service. Burial will be in Johnson cemetery, Danville.

Visitation will be from 2 to 6 p.m. Sunday at Sunset Funeral Home and Cremation Center, 3940 N. Vermilion St., Danville. A prayer service will be at 6 p.m. Sunday. The Rev. Robert Mann will officiate.
